This sublime beach hotel is situated in the popular tourist hub of Puerto de la Cruz. The airport is about 25 minutes’ drive away. The hotel enjoys an idyllic beachside setting opposite Martianez, the popular seawater swimming baths. The complex is nestled amidst gardens, which stretch over 1,500 metres squared, blending effortlessly with its surroundings. Guests can enjoy the sumptuous delights of the buffet-style meals, with exquisite dishes, relax in the outdoor pool area or have a couple of drinks in the bar. Visitors will be impressed by the stylish rooms, which come well equipped with modern amenities and offer the ideal surroundings in which to relax and unwind at the end of the day.

Hotel location is right on the front of a pedestrianised walkway,easy access via a few steps or a ramp. Reception area huge and to be honest,not very awe inspiring by its decor,but don't let that put you off! Rooms offer twin or double beds,large wall mounted t.v. which receives,as well as the usual Spanish and other nationality channels,also gets basic English channels(BBC1/2/4,ITV1/2/3/4,Film 4).Two double wardrobes including shelves,plenty hanging space but no drawers.Great sea facing balcony. Electric kettle, tea,coffee and sugar provided and replenished. Bathroom includes a bidet and a very powerful, easily regulated shower in the bath,liquid soap,shampoo and conditioner included. Rooms cleaned daily,bedsheets changed halfway through the week,bath/hand towels when requested. We had paid a bit extra for a premium double room,which included a balcony with a sea view,safety deposit box,mini fridge(fair size),ceiling fan and air con unit(silent),all included in price of the room. Mealtimes are buffet style,breakfast(7-10),Lunch(1-3) and Dinner(6;30-9;30).We were half board and found all the breakfasts and dinners were varied,catered for everyone and where,by and large, on the whole tasty, Garden area of hotel well tended and one could sit in shade or sunshine around this area. Concert room with bar offered varied shows of an evening,though a few were postponed whilst we were there due to the Football World Cup. Was pleasantly surprised to find beer and wine prices were very reasonable and in most cases cheaper than the bars and restaurants in the vicinity,very unusual for a hotel! Also spirits and cocktails available,but as my wife and I don't drink these,can't comment. Pool area is enclosed,plenty of loungers and parasols around,lifeguard on duty during pool hours,poolside bar for drinks,snacks,ice creams etc.. Although at first sight the area doesn't look big enough for the size of the hotel,it is! A solarium to just sunbathe on is situated on a balcony one floor up an exterior staircase, Hotel other atributes include a gym and an outdoor recreation area with a giant "connect 4 game,ring toss,table tennis,chessboard and pieces amongst other "games". Major criticism is that the hotel has 3 public elevators and especially during mealtimes,morning and evening,you can be waiting a while to access a lift!
